Regrets
As she tiptoed through the thoughts,
Scattered across her mind,
She tentatively stepped on,
Afraid of the horrors she might find.
She doubted her emotions,
She refused to trust her heart,
They had led her astray before,
Then tore her world apart.
She chose to forgive herself,
She lay her ghosts to rest,
Her past now behind her,
The pain eased in her chest.
One day at a time,
She knew she'd have to take,
To a brand-new future,
She has new memories to make.
